  1. If I can offer a tip, and one that may seem rebarbative to many, but I would consider applying to the same places your referees got their PhDs from, if that's at all possible. I applied to four top 15 universities, and was accepted to the two where my referees had got their degrees from (whereas the other two I had no connection with, and was rejected from). In some respects, it may seem obvious, but I don't think I've seen it mentioned on this forum before. An admissions committee is more likely, I think, to trust the words of someone they're familiar with, and someone who successfully went through their program. Of course, this is not at all a hard and fast rule—and may indeed play no role whatsoever in the committee's decision. It's just something to think about!
  2. It's a great question, and one I grappled with when submitting my writing sample (I was accepted into an ivy comp lit program). My advice would be: they'll be impressed. If your sample is written in English, but your quotes are in another language, then that will seem ideal to many comp lit programs. However, I'd consider providing translations in the footnote. It's not entirely necessary, but it will demonstrate to your readers that you have a firm grasp of the material. Do PM me if you have any other questions!
